Transaction 5585d74e1e577e20ee06022856058d361e878fdd2a3287a8c1d44fe4ba647a4d

61 Input
2 Outputs
  • 5585d74e1e577e20ee06022856058d361e878fdd2a3287a8c1d44fe4ba647a4d:0
  • value  586732500
    address  3D5haEJr9vgfxWAEr3zHhTmtYnKFT2hRTS
  • 5585d74e1e577e20ee06022856058d361e878fdd2a3287a8c1d44fe4ba647a4d:1
  • value  9235310
    address  bc1q6uvlvfcq0yh6sd7xdd2lj5lr5ea6d3tnnzx8t7